1400. How to enhance memory



Teacher A said to teacher B, “Memory for learning a language? Essential! 

I know a teacher that has a rather large memory. The point is that he has practiced and trained a lot to learn new words. Now his memory is so big. Sometimes he can remember and retrieve a word he has seen one single time. 

Something also primordial and essential is to learn the irregular verbs – they’re about 150 at maximum. 

Usually we utilize 80 of them approximately.
